SEE… Volume Step inside this ingenious interactive installation of light and sound, which responds to human movement. Victoria & Albert Museum, Cromwell Road, London SW7. T: 020 942 2000 www.vam.ac.uk until 28 Jan

DO… Yinka Shonibare Join us for the second in a series of four lectures organised jointly by the Constance Howard    Resource and   Research Centre   in Textiles and Selvedge. Turner Prize nominee (2004) Yinka Shonibare   will explore the relationship between  textiles  and post colonialism.     Ian Gulland Lecture Theatre, Goldsmiths College, University of London, T: 020 7717 2210 goldsmiths.ac.uk/constance-howard/events Saturday 3 Feb, 11am-1pm, £10

READ… Alexander Girard Designs for Herman Miller In conjunction with the exhibition Vibrant Modern at MOMA in San Francisco (until 25 Feb) this vividly illustrated book is a comprehensive view of the iconoclastic textile designer's work as director at Herman Miller from 1952-1973. Schiffer Publishing Ltd, ISBN 0764306057, £39.95 www.selvedge-bookshop.org

This month we focus on the importance of textiles for charities. UNICEF are still working to help those devastated by the 2005 earthquake in Pakistan to rebuild their lives. A recent consignment of winter kits including blankets and quilts will help homeless victims get through another harsh winter but the long term picture is still bleak. Contact UNICEF to make a donation www.unicef.org.uk. VSO www.vso.org.uk are calling for a marketing expert to develop a five year strategy for Mongolia's textile industry. Knowledge of cashmere and yak knitwear are a prerequisite. E-mail your CV to enquiry@vso.org.uk. Also, in Paris, the French charity supporting autism, Autistes san Frontiers benefited from the sale of Georges Braque's tapestry Les Oiseaux Bleus, www.autistessansfrontieres.com.

The rich quilting legacy of four generations of African-American women in rural Alabama has been celebrated by the U.S. Postal Service. The Quilts of Gee's Bend commemorative postage stamps have been issued as part of the American Treasures Series. www.usps.com
